16th Baltic Sea Summer School on Epilepsy

Online

4 - 19 October 2023

ILAE Curriculum Learning Objectives addressed by this course

The 16th edition of the well-known Baltic Sea Summer School on Epilepsy (BSSSE 16) will take place as a virtual event, in the afternoons of 4, 6, 11, 18, and 19 October 2023.

Target audience

The BSSSE are primarily addressed to medical postgraduates and junior researchers (age usually up to 40 years) with a special clinical or scientific interest in epilepsy.

Topics

All topics relate to the Curriculum of the ILAE Academy. They include EEG (Norm variants and artifacts; Recognizing spikes), Imaging (MRI and other imaging methods in epilepsy), Pharmacotherapy (How to use ASM monitoring; Where are we with the newest ASM generation?), Status epilepticus, Epileptic aura, Epilepsy and mental handicap, Subjective factors in epilepsy treatment, Neuropathological aspects, and Case-oriented study (3 sessions with distinguished tutors).

Format

The BSSSE will accept 40 participants who work in 4 groups of parallel webtorials. Webtorials are a strictly interactive format where a small group works with a faculty member. Active participation is expected and encouraged by the tutors. Fluency in English is a precondition. Webtorials are not recorded for later use.

Registration

Participation is free of charge, and participants will be accepted on a first come – first served basis. The deadline for applications is 15 August 2023. The application must include an application form and a CV plus a one-sentence presentation to be given to the tutors.

Certificates

Certificates will only be given to participants who are present at all webtorials and who fill in the mandatory course evaluation.
